Breaking Down Songs ⁣for Effective Learning

learning“>Breaking Down Songs‍ for Effective Learning

Ever find yourself struggling to ​learn‍ a⁢ new song on the guitar or piano? Well, fear ⁤not, because we’ve‌ got some tips and tricks to ⁤help ⁣you break⁣ down songs for effective‍ learning!

First things ‌first, listen to ⁢the song on repeat. And we mean repeat. Like, to‌ the point where your neighbors start banging on the walls.​ This will help you get a feel for the rhythm and melody of the song.

Next, break the song down into sections. Start with ​the ⁣intro,‌ then move⁤ on to the verse,⁤ chorus, ⁣bridge, and any other sections. This⁣ will make learning the song ⁣more manageable and less overwhelming. And ‍remember, Rome wasn’t built in‍ a day!

  • Focus on learning​ one⁢ section at a time.
  • Practice each section until you can⁢ play ​it ‌flawlessly.
  • Don’t be afraid to​ slow down the tempo⁣ to really nail those tricky parts.

Incorporating Advanced Techniques in⁢ Your Practice ⁢Routine

Incorporating​ Advanced⁤ Techniques in Your⁢ Practice Routine

So, you want to take your practice routine to the next level? Time to incorporate some advanced techniques that will have ‌you​ playing like a pro in no ‌time!

First ​up, let’s talk about sweep picking. This technique involves‍ using a pick in a continuous motion to play multiple notes⁣ across different strings. It may seem ‍intimidating at first, ⁢but with enough practice, you’ll be sweeping‍ through those arpeggios like a​ boss.

Next, let’s dive ⁣into tapping. This ⁣technique involves using one or‍ both hands to tap the fretboard, creating ‍rapid-fire notes and mind-blowing solos. Channel ⁤your⁣ inner Eddie ⁤Van Halen and start tapping away!

Lastly, ⁤don’t forget about ⁢ legato playing. This technique involves using hammer-ons⁤ and pull-offs⁣ to create smooth and fluid⁤ lines. ‍It takes some finesse, but once you master it, your playing will sound incredibly slick.
